How Chinese aI Startup DeepSeek made a Design That Rivals OpenAI

On January 20, DeepSeek, a fairly unidentified AI research study laboratory from China, launched an open source design that’s rapidly end up being the talk of the town in Silicon Valley. According to a paper authored by the business, DeepSeek-R1 beats the market’s leading models like OpenAI o1 on several math and thinking benchmarks. In truth, on lots of metrics that matter-capability, cost, openness-DeepSeek is offering Western AI giants a run for their money.

DeepSeek’s success indicate an unintentional outcome of the tech cold war between the US and China. US export controls have badly cut the capability of Chinese tech companies to complete on AI in the Western way-that is, definitely scaling up by buying more chips and training for a longer duration of time. As an outcome, the majority of Chinese companies have actually concentrated on downstream applications rather than building their own models. But with its most current release, DeepSeek shows that there’s another way to win: by revamping the foundational structure of AI models and using restricted resources more efficiently.

” Unlike lots of Chinese AI firms that rely heavily on access to advanced hardware, DeepSeek has actually focused on making the most of software-driven resource optimization,” describes Marina Zhang, an associate professor at the University of Technology Sydney, who studies Chinese innovations. “DeepSeek has embraced open source techniques, pooling cumulative know-how and cultivating collective development. This method not only mitigates resource constraints however likewise speeds up the development of innovative technologies, setting DeepSeek apart from more insular rivals.”

So who is behind the AI startup? And why are they unexpectedly releasing an industry-leading design and offering it away totally free? WIRED spoke to experts on China’s AI industry and check out comprehensive interviews with DeepSeek founder Liang Wenfeng to piece together the story behind the company’s meteoric rise. DeepSeek did not react to a number of queries sent by WIRED.

A Star Hedge Fund in China

Even within the Chinese AI market, DeepSeek is an unconventional player. It began as Fire-Flyer, a deep-learning research study branch of High-Flyer, one of China’s best-performing quantitative hedge funds. Founded in 2015, the hedge fund quickly increased to prominence in China, ending up being the first quant hedge fund to raise over 100 billion RMB (around $15 billion). (Since 2021, the number has actually dipped to around $8 billion, though High-Flyer stays one of the most crucial quant hedge funds in the country.)

For several years, High-Flyer had actually been stockpiling GPUs and developing Fire-Flyer supercomputers to evaluate financial information. Then, in 2023, Liang, who has a master’s degree in computer technology, chose to put the fund’s resources into a brand-new company called DeepSeek that would construct its own advanced models-and ideally establish artificial basic intelligence. It was as if Jane Street had decided to become an AI start-up and burn its cash on scientific research study.

Bold vision. But somehow, it worked. “DeepSeek represents a brand-new generation of Chinese tech business that focus on long-term technological improvement over fast commercialization,” says Zhang.

Liang informed the Chinese tech publication 36Kr that the choice was driven by scientific curiosity instead of a desire to make a profit. “I would not be able to find an industrial factor [for founding DeepSeek] even if you ask me to,” he described. “Because it’s not worth it commercially. Basic science research has a very low return-on-investment ratio. When OpenAI’s early investors offered it money, they sure weren’t thinking of how much return they would get. Rather, it was that they really wanted to do this thing.”

Today, DeepSeek is among the only leading AI in China that does not rely on financing from tech giants like Baidu, Alibaba, or ByteDance.

A Young Group of Geniuses Eager to Prove Themselves

According to Liang, when he put together DeepSeek’s research study group, he was not looking for skilled engineers to construct a consumer-facing item. Instead, he concentrated on PhD trainees from China’s top universities, consisting of Peking University and Tsinghua University, who were excited to prove themselves. Many had been published in leading journals and won awards at international scholastic conferences, however did not have industry experience, according to the Chinese tech publication QBitAI.

” Our core technical positions are mainly filled by people who graduated this year or in the previous a couple of years,” Liang told 36Kr in 2023. The hiring method assisted develop a collective company culture where people were free to use adequate computing resources to pursue unorthodox research study jobs. It’s a starkly different method of operating from established internet companies in China, where teams are often competing for resources. (A recent example: ByteDance accused a former intern-a distinguished scholastic award winner, no less-of sabotaging his colleagues’ work in order to hoard more computing resources for his team.)

Liang stated that trainees can be a much better suitable for high-investment, low-profit research. “Most individuals, when they are young, can commit themselves entirely to an objective without practical considerations,” he explained. His pitch to potential hires is that DeepSeek was produced to “solve the hardest concerns worldwide.”

The truth that these young researchers are practically completely informed in China contributes to their drive, professionals say. “This more youthful generation also embodies a sense of patriotism, particularly as they browse US limitations and choke points in crucial hardware and software application innovations,” describes Zhang. “Their decision to conquer these barriers reflects not just personal aspiration however also a wider dedication to advancing China’s position as a global development leader.”

Innovation Substantiated of a Crisis

In October 2022, the US federal government started putting together export controls that seriously restricted Chinese AI business from accessing advanced chips like Nvidia’s H100. The move presented a problem for DeepSeek. The firm had begun with a stockpile of 10,000 A100’s, however it required more to compete with firms like OpenAI and Meta. “The issue we are facing has actually never ever been funding, but the export control on advanced chips,” Liang told 36Kr in a second interview in 2024.

DeepSeek had to create more efficient methods to train its models. “They enhanced their design architecture using a battery of engineering tricks-custom communication schemes in between chips, lowering the size of fields to conserve memory, and ingenious usage of the mix-of-models method,” states Wendy Chang, a software engineer turned policy expert at the Mercator Institute for China Studies. “Many of these approaches aren’t brand-new concepts, however integrating them successfully to produce an innovative design is an amazing task.”

DeepSeek has likewise made considerable development on Multi-head Latent Attention (MLA) and Mixture-of-Experts, 2 technical styles that make DeepSeek models more economical by requiring less computing resources to train. In fact, DeepSeek’s most current model is so efficient that it required one-tenth the computing power of Meta’s equivalent Llama 3.1 model to train, according to the research institution Epoch AI.

DeepSeek’s willingness to share these innovations with the public has actually earned it substantial goodwill within the international AI research study neighborhood. For many Chinese AI companies, establishing open source designs is the only method to play catch-up with their Western counterparts, since it brings in more users and factors, which in turn help the models grow. “They have actually now demonstrated that advanced models can be constructed using less, though still a lot of, money and that the current norms of model-building leave a lot of space for optimization,” Chang states. “We are sure to see a lot more attempts in this instructions moving forward.”

The news could spell problem for the current US export controls that focus on producing computing resource traffic jams. “Existing quotes of how much AI computing power China has, and what they can attain with it, might be overthrown,” Chang says.
